What this study is about
This trial is testing if providing encouragement to adopt a healthy eating plan with fresh fruits and vegetables, along with guidance on weight management, will lower blood pressure and blood sugar in adults with high blood pressure and type 2 diabetes. Participants will receive either self-shopping DASH diet advice or coaching from a health professional.
